/**
* Return the length of an fixed size array.
* Unlike sizeof this function returns the number of elements
* of the given type.
*
* @param x The pointer to the first element of the array
* @return The number of elements
*/
#define lengthof(x) (sizeof(x) / sizeof(x[0]))
/**
* Get the end element of an fixed size array.
*
* @param x The pointer to the first element of the array
* @return The pointer past to the last element of the array
*/
#define endof(x) (&x[lengthof(x)])
/**
* Get the last element of an fixed size array.
*
* @param x The pointer to the first element of the array
* @return The pointer to the last element of the array
*/
#define lastof(x) (&x[lengthof(x) - 1])
